Lost Screen Print #9 - Rousseau's Transmission by Dan McCarthy

Ok, this is getting out of hand. This week’s Lost screen print, “Rousseau’s Transmission” by Dan McCarthy, sold out before I even got a chance to look at it! These prints in honor of Lost: The Final Season have gotten so popular with the television show’s fervent fan base, in order to get your hands on one you pretty much have to be at the website within the hour a new print is released. I really like this print for two reasons: 1) it is an amazing example of McCarthy’s beautiful work (you can see more here) and 2) it showcases one of my favorite Lost scenes, the moment Shannon first translates Rousseau’s radio transmission.

Damon, Carlton and A Polar Bear Limited Edition Lost Screen Prints - Rousseau's Transmission by Dan McCarthy
Rousseau’s Transmission” is the ninth screen print released on Damon, Carlton and A Polar Bear in honor of Lost’s sixth and final season. Dan McCarthy’s limited edition Lost screen print “Rousseau’s Transmission” measures 18”x30” (the largest Lost screen print to date), has a run size of 300 pieces, and comes hand signed and numbered by the artist. The print sells for $50 each and could have been purchased here before it sold out.

ThinkGeek Exclusive Zombie Mez-Itz Vinyl Figure

Mezco Toyz is doing an amazing job releasing new Mez-Itz vinyl figures on a pretty consistent basis. The popular toy line continues with the new ThinkGeek Exclusive Green Skinned Zombie Mez-Itz. Together you can reenact your favorite zombie stories, or create new adventures of your own while feasting on the entrails of the unsuspecting!

Mezco Toyz - ThinkGeek.com Exclusive Green Skinned Zombie Mez-Itz Vinyl Figure
The new colored Zombie Mez-Itz is available exclusively at ThinkGeek.com and can be purchased here for just $14.99. Limited to just 500 figures, this festering, green skinned, undead terror stands 6 inches tall and features 5 points of articulation, including a ball jointed neck, and individually rooted hairs.

Gloomy Bear 8 Inch Dunny by Mori Chack

Kidrobot - Gloomy Bear 8 Inch Dunny by Mori Chack
Mori Chack’s adorably lethal creation looms larger and more violent than ever in this Dunny version of his evil icon. Even though Kidrobot’s been going Gloomy Bear crazy recently, The Blot’s still a little surprised by this release. It’s been years since Kidrobot’s released an 8” Dunny of a previously released 3” figure, much less an 8” version of pre-existing popular character. Regardless, I’ve got a sneaking suspicious this figure is going to be really popular, especially since an ultra rare variant figure will be inserted into select Gloomy Bear boxes.

Kidrobot - Gloomy Bear 8 Inch Dunny and Packaging by Mori Chack
Gloomy Bear 8 Inch Dunny by Mori Chack Front and Back View
The 8 inch Gloomy Bear Dunny is limited to 1500 figures and has a bloody rare chase! Retailing for $75 each, the Gloomy Bear 8” Dunny attacks Kidrobot stores, kidrobot.com, and select retailers on November 5th, 2009.

The A-Team Motion Picture First Look

There are very few shows from the 80’s The Blot loves as much as The A-Team, which is why I am so horrified that the long rumored movie remake is finally happening. Has a movie based on television show ever worked and/or been successful? Off the top of my head I’d say an emphatic no, which is why I have some seriously grave misgivings about 20th Century Fox’s decision to go forward with this film. The A-Team's only saving grace is that it stars Liam Neeson as Col. John “Hannibal” Smith. Neeson is a true professional and one of the best actors working today, so at least he brings a little credibility to this ill advised re-imagining.

The A-Team Motion Picture First Look - Quinton ‘Rampage’ Jackson as Sgt. ‘B.A.’ Baracus, Liam Neeson as Col. John ‘Hannibal’ Smith, Sharlto Copley as Capt. ‘Howling Mad’ Murdock & Bradley Cooper as Lt. Templeton ‘Faceman’ Peck
The photo above is courtesy of ComingSoon.net and is the first image of the all new, all different A-Team. (link) The movie stars Liam Neeson as “Hannibal” Smith, Bradley Cooper as Lt. Templeton "Faceman" Peck, Sharlto Copley as Capt. "Howling Mad" Murdock and Quinton "Rampage" Jackson stars as Sgt. "B.A." Baracus (the role that made Mr. T a household name). The film is also rumored to star Jessica Biel as an Army general pursuing the team (and one of Face’s ex-lovers) and Patrick Wilson as a CIA operative. The A-Team is being directed by Joe Carnahan and produced by Ridley and Tony Scott.

The A-Team is currently scheduled to debut in theaters on June 11, 2010. I can’t wait to see if 20th Century Fox sticks with this date or pushes the film back due to its mediocrity.

How I Met Your Mother





While HIMYM’s 100th episode is not scheduled to air until January, The Blot can’t wait that long to talk about it. Evidently there are some big plans in place for the show's landmark 100th episode. At this point, there are two key things we know about the episode and if both hold true it might turn out to be the best episode of How I Met Your Mother ever.

First of all, EW.com’s Michael Ausiello is reporting that “Rachel Bilson has landed a pivotal – some would say legendary – role in How I Met Your Mother’s 100th episode.” (link) Last month HIMYM Exec Producer Craig Thomas told Ausiello that the milestone episode would feature “some serious mother action,” adding, “it’ll be the closest Ted’s ever come to [discovering who she is]. He’s getting a step closer every episode this season, and episode 100 [we] kind of go bananas with it.” (link)

But that’s not all! Ausiello is also reporting that the milestone episode will climax with what exec producer Craig Thomas calls a “big-ass musical” number headlined by the show’s resident song-and-dance man, Neil Patrick Harris. (link) “There will be a huge Barney story culminating in an enormous musical number that we’re going to spend way too much of Twentieth Television’s money on,” Thomas says with a laugh. “Fans of Neil’s performance at the Emmys will enjoy the ending of the episode. It’s not a musical episode, but all of a sudden it becomes one. It’ll probably be one of the craziest things we’ve ever done on the show.” (link)
